    Jenson Button, Brawn GP Win Rain-Soaked, Red-Flagged Malaysian Grand Prix

    Following his second pole, Jenson Button of Brawn GP maintains his immaculate record in a race suspended after 31 laps of torrential rain. BMW's Nick Heidfeld and Toyota's Timo Glock round out an unusual podium. More »
